Regular eye tests are very important, not just to check if your prescription has changed but also to check for conditions that can impair your sight.
Early detection is always better, as some of these can develop very gradually without symptoms, and you may not be aware the condition is developing. In the eye test, we will check for all these conditions. The eyes being the windows to your inner body, we can also check for health conditions such as high blood pressure and diabetes.

If you are unable to get to an optician unaided, then we can come to your home to provide a free NHS eye test and dispense spectacles if required. You can request an appointment for yourself or someone else, and we can visit people in care homes. The NHS (National Health Service) recommends an annual eye test for anyone over the age of 70 and every 2 years for anyone over the age of 60. Yearly eye tests are also advised for diabetics and people who are 40 years old and over with a family history of glaucoma.
